Stop TB Partnership Indonesia

The Stop TB Partnership Indonesia (STPI) is a national platform of Stop TB Partnership. STPI provides a platform of inter-sectorial partnership that supports National Tuberculosis Program (NTP) since 2013. This organization consists of 75 national and international partners that collaborate to end TB in Indonesia. STPI operates under the strategic direction of a wide range of expertise, such as the Board of Trustees and Advisory Board, representing public health practitioners, academia, development partners, as well as public and private sector.
